Full NMR analysis of annomontine, methoxy- annomontine and N-hydroxyannomontine pyrimidine-beta-carboline alkaloids.

Emmanoel Vilaça Costa1, Maria Lúcia Belém Pinheiro, Afonso Duarte Leão de Souza, Adriane Gama Dos Santos, Francinete Ramos Campos, Antonio Gilberto Ferreira, Andersson Barison.   

Abstract

Using modern NMR techniques, including 1H--13C and 1H--15N heteronuclear correlation experiments, the complete and unambiguous 1H, 13C, and 15N NMR chemical shift assignments of annomontine, methoxyannomontine, and N-hydroxyannomontine pyrimidine-beta-carboline alkaloids were performed. All 1H--1H scalar coupling constants and signal multiplicities were determined, and all nOe observations were also included. Copyright (c) 2007 John Wiley & Sons, Ltd.
